The Tektronix AFG3251 is a single-channel 240 MHz Arbitrary/Function Generator from the AFG3000 series. Featuring a 2 GS/s sampling rate, 14-bit vertical resolution, and a 128 kpoint arbitrary memory depth, it provides high performance, versatility, and precise signal generation. It incorporates a highly stable timebase with a drift of only ±1 ppm per year, a 5.6-inch color TFT display, and versatile interface options including USB, LAN, and GPIB.

Frequency Specifications
| Parameter | Value |
|---|---|
| Sine Wave Frequency Range | 1 µHz to 240 MHz |
| Square Wave Frequency Range | 1 µHz to 120 MHz |
| Pulse Wave Frequency Range | 1 mHz to 120 MHz |
| Ramp Wave Frequency Range | 1 µHz to 2.4 MHz |
| Arbitrary Waveform Frequency Range | 1 mHz to 120 MHz |
| Noise Bandwidth | 240 MHz |
| Frequency Resolution | 1 µHz or 12 digits |
| Frequency Accuracy | ±1 ppm of setting |
| Long-term Aging Rate | ±1 ppm per year |

Amplitude and Output Characteristics
| Parameter | Value |
|---|---|
| Amplitude Range into 50 Ohms | 50 mVp-p to 5 Vp-p (≤ 200 MHz), 50 mVp-p to 4 Vp-p (> 200 MHz) |
| Amplitude Range into Open Circuit | 100 mVp-p to 10 Vp-p (≤ 200 MHz), 100 mVp-p to 8 Vp-p (> 200 MHz) |
| Amplitude Resolution | 0.1 mVp-p, 0.1 mVrms, 1 mV, 0.1 dBm or 4 digits |
| Amplitude Accuracy | ±(1% of setting + 1 mV) at 1 kHz, 1 Vp-p, 50 Ohms load |
| DC Offset Range | ±2.5 Vpk (into 50 Ohms, ≤ 200 MHz), ±2 Vpk (into 50 Ohms, > 200 MHz) |
| DC Offset Resolution | 1 mV |
| DC Offset Accuracy | ±(1% of |setting| + 2 mV + 0.5% of amplitude (Vp-p)) |
| Output Impedance | 50 Ohms |
| Output Protection | Short-circuit protected |
| Amplitude Flatness | ±0.15 dB (≤ 5 MHz), ±0.3 dB (> 5 MHz to 100 MHz), ±0.5 dB (> 100 MHz to 200 MHz), ±1.0 dB (> 200 MHz to 240 MHz) |
Signal Purity and Waveform Characteristics
| Parameter | Value |
|---|---|
| Sine Wave Harmonic Distortion | <-40 dBc (10 MHz to 100 MHz, 1 Vp-p) |
| Square Wave Rise/Fall Time | ≤ 2.5 ns |
| Square Wave Overshoot | < 5% |
| Pulse Width Range | 4.0 ns to 999.9 s |
| Pulse Width Resolution | 10 ps or 5 digits |
| Pulse Duty Cycle Range | 0.001% to 99.999% (limitations of min pulse width apply) |
| Pulse Edge Time Range | 2.5 ns to 625 s |
| Pulse Jitter (RMS) | < 100 ps (typical 30 ps) |
| Ramp Wave Linearity | ≤ 0.1% of peak output at 1 kHz |
| Ramp Wave Symmetry Range | 0.0% to 100.0% |
